wow that's a good price too for the coupe - man is it me or are the C6's depreciating faster than the C5's did?
I believe that they are. I remember tracking the prices of C5s and did not see the first C5 go below $40,000 until the beginning of 2004, more than 7 years after their introduction (plus their price was lower than the C6 to begin with!) But here we are now only 3 years since the C6 came out and already one has gone under $40k and a lot of them are hovering in the $45k to $50k range. I even saw an 06 vert for under $50k in the Trader this week!
So while it is bad news for those who worry about this sort of thing, it's good news for people like me who want to pick up a used one for a song someday. Magazine titles are:
Corvette Magazine
Corvette Quarterly
Corvette Fever
Corvette Enthusiast
Vette
And there is a 5th publication not directly associated with the Corvette called "GM High-Tech". They get into the engine, tranny, suspension, electrical, etc of all GM high performance automobiles. Very good magazine if you like the mechanical side of it.
